The National Garborg Centre, often referred to as Garborgsenteret, is a museum dedicated to the life and works of the writer Arne Garborg. It was opened on September 5, 2012, and is located in Bryne, in the Time municipality where Garborg spent his childhood and youth. The centre is a part of the Jærmuseet.
The Garborg Centre serves as a national platform to foster interest in Arne and Hulda Garborg, their ideas and visions. Its mission is to inspire social engagement, reading, and creativity. It stands as a vibrant centre for democracy, knowledge, and creative power.
